1. Expansion of Coverage
One of the key future plans for GamStop is the expansion of its coverage to include more online gambling operators. Currently, not all online casinos and betting sites are members of GamStop, which means that some problem gamblers may still be able to access their services even after self-excluding through the scheme. By increasing the number of operators that are part of GamStop, more players will be protected from the harms of gambling addiction.
In addition to expanding coverage to more operators, there are also discussions about making GamStop mandatory for all UK-licensed gambling sites. This would mean that no online casino or sports betting site could operate in the UK without being a member of GamStop. While this may present challenges for some operators, it would undoubtedly strengthen the effectiveness of the scheme in helping problem gamblers stay in control of their habits.
2. Enhanced Self-Exclusion Tools
Another aspect of GamStop’s future plans involves the development of enhanced self-exclusion tools for users. Currently, when a player self-excludes through GamStop, they are blocked from accessing gambling sites for a set period, typically ranging from six months to five years. However, there is room for improvement in this area.
One idea that has been proposed is the introduction of customizable self-exclusion periods, allowing players to choose the length of their exclusion based on their individual needs. For example, some players may benefit from shorter exclusion periods that can be extended if needed, while others may prefer longer exclusions to provide more robust protection.
In addition to customizable exclusion periods, there is also talk of implementing cooling-off periods that would prevent players from cancelling their self-exclusion prematurely. This additional layer of protection would give problem gamblers a chance to reflect on their decision and seek help before resuming their gambling activities.
3. Integration with Support Services
To further enhance the effectiveness of GamStop, there are plans to integrate the scheme with other support services for problem gamblers. This could include linking GamStop accounts with counseling services, helplines, and other resources that can provide additional assistance to those struggling with gambling addiction.
By creating a more holistic support network for problem gamblers, GamStop aims to address the underlying causes of addictive behavior and help individuals overcome their gambling problems for good. This integrated approach recognizes that self-exclusion is just one part of the solution and that additional support is often needed to achieve long-term recovery.
4. Improved Data Sharing and Monitoring
Another key area of focus for GamStop’s future plans is improving data sharing and monitoring capabilities. Currently, when a player self-excludes through GamStop, their details are shared with participating operators to ensure that they are blocked from accessing their services. However, there is potential to enhance this data-sharing process to provide more comprehensive protection for problem gamblers.
One idea that has been explored is the introduction of real-time monitoring systems that can track the browsing behavior of self-excluded individuals and immediately block access to gambling sites. By leveraging advanced technology and data analytics, GamStop could create a more proactive and responsive system that helps problem gamblers stay on track with their recovery goals.
In addition to real-time monitoring, there are discussions about enhancing the sharing of behavioral data between operators to identify patterns of harmful gambling behavior more effectively. By pooling resources and expertise, participating operators can work together to create a safer and more responsible gambling environment for all players.
